About the role

Original posting from Li Thermal Works via Greenhouse

Thermal Works LLC has an exciting opportunity for a hands-on Product Testing Technician to to support R&D lab operations and equipment testing. This role is responsible for setting up, operating, testing, and troubleshooting thermal systems and components used in product development and validation.

This position is ideal for someone with strong field experience in refrigeration, hydronic systems, and electrical power who is comfortable working in a lab environment where systems are frequently built, modified, and tested.

Key Responsibilities

Include but are not limited to:

Set up, operate, and modify thermal system test loops

Perform hands-on testing, diagnostics, and troubleshooting

Support development and execution of test procedures

Collect and validate performance data (temperature, flow, pressure, power)

Identify issues and support root cause analysis

Assist with system improvements and design feedback

Maintain lab equipment and testing infrastructure

Ensure safe handling of refrigerants and compliance with applicable regulations

Qualifications

Required:

EPA certification (or equivalent) for refrigerant handling

Strong hands-on experience with refrigeration systems

Experience with hydronic systems (pumps, valves, glycol/water systems)

Working knowledge of electrical systems (single- and three-phase power)

Ability to read and interpret schematics, wiring diagrams, and P&IDs

Proven troubleshooting ability across mechanical and electrical systems

Preferred:

Experience in lab testing or product development environments

Familiarity with controls, sensors, and instrumentation

HVAC/R technical training or equivalent experience
